ds18b20误差分析
时间: 2023-09-24 16:08:05 浏览: 61
DS18B20是一种数字温度传感器,它具有高精度、数字输出、可编程分辨率等优点。然而,由于各种原因,DS18B20的输出可能存在误差。这些误差的来源包括:
1. 硬件误差:例如,电源波动、噪声、接触不良等原因都可能导致传感器输出的误差。
2. 软件误差:例如,程序算法的问题、读取数据的延迟等原因都可能导致传感器输出的误差。
3. 环境误差:例如,温度传感器的位置、周围环境的温度、湿度等因素都可能对传感器输出造成影响。
对于DS18B20的误差分析,可以采取以下方法:
1. 校准传感器:使用标准温度计对DS18B20进行校准,以减小误差。
2. 优化硬件:例如,使用稳定的电源、保证接触良好、增加滤波电路等方法,可以减小硬件误差。
3. 优化软件:例如,优化程序算法、减小读取数据的延迟等方法,可以减小软件误差。
4. 控制环境:例如,控制温度传感器的位置、保持周围环境的稳定等方法,可以减小环境误差。
需要注意的是,即使采取了上述措施,DS18B20的输出仍然可能存在一定的误差。因此,在实际应用中,需要根据具体情况来评估误差的大小,并采取相应的措施来保证测量结果的准确性。
相关问题
关于ds18b20的误差分析
DS18B20是一种数字温度传感器,其精度受到多种因素的影响。常见的误差来源包括:
1.供电电压不稳定:DS18B20的工作电源范围为3V至5.5V,如果供电电压不稳定,则会导致温度读数不准确。
2.环境温度变化:DS18B20的测量精度取决于其环境温度,如果环境温度变化较大,则会影响其测量结果。
3.读取速度不同:DS18B20的读取速度越慢,则测量精度越高。
4.传感器位置不同:DS18B20的位置不同,受到的环境温度也不同,因此测量结果也会有所不同。
5.传感器自身精度:DS18B20本身具有一定的测量精度,但是由于生产工艺等因素,不同的传感器其精度可能会有所不同。
因此,在使用DS18B20进行温度测量时,需要考虑以上因素对其测量精度的影响,并进行相应的误差分析和校正。
DS18B20测量水温的误差分析
DS18B20是一种数字温度传感器,它使用1-wire接口与微处理器连接,可用于测量液体、气体和固体的温度。在测量水温时,需要注意以下因素可能会影响温度测量的准确性:
1. 温度传感器的位置:温度传感器应该尽可能靠近水的中心位置,以避免受到周围环境的影响。
2. 温度传感器的安装方式:安装方式也会影响测量结果的准确性。传感器应该与水接触充分,避免温度传递过程中的热量损失。
3. 水的流动:水的流动也会影响温度传感器的测量结果。如果水流速度太快,温度传感器就很难得到准确的测量数据。
4. DS18B20的精度: DS18B20的精度为±0.5℃,但是由于生产批次和使用环境的不同,实际精度可能会有所不同。
5. 环境温度:环境温度的变化也会影响水温的测量结果,因此需要注意传感器的安装位置和环境温度变化。
综上所述,测量水温时需要注意以上因素,以获得准确的温度测量数据。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)